A four-prop Dash 7 aircraft of Asia Spirit had us (and about 30 others) winging 1 hour down south to Taclan town/airport on Aclan island. What an impressive landing!! Shades of the old Kai Tak airport at Hong Kong... I'm certain the boundary fence was actually in the sea, and the wheels just grazed the top of it... all you could see was sea.... until 1 second later - the wheels touched down!!

A very "holiday" atmosphere (as you'd expect) - reminded me a bit of Koh Samui airstrip - into a couple of SUV's - drive 400 yards to the "ferries".... this is where you realise "those who know" - and "those who don't know". Walk down the beach, through about 10 feet of maybe 3 feet deep water - and onto a banca/ferry - some of the ladies got carried on-board!! Wimps!! The trick is - to wear "suitable" clothes/shoes for this stage of the trip (those who know - did)!

So - off we go - about 20 minutes - across from Aclan - to Boracay island... all along the beach - lots of boats/activity, and then pull up onto the beach at The Regency Hotel - similar routine... off the banca, through the water - up the beach and into the hotel.
